    How can I prevent my child from developing learning difficulties?

    I'm a first time mum and want to know what preventative measures i can take to ensure my 18 month old doesnt develop any learning difficulties?

    As we don't know exactly what causes learning difficulties, it is difficult to know how to ‘prevent’ difficulties. What we do know is that providing your child with a rich learning environment, with lots of different experiences can be beneficial to their overall development.
